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
506602 9291 73
6715 318952894 56
6715 318952894 56
1426 150093 8741
All about undefined
Interested in learning more?
6715 318952894 56
1426 150093 8741
See more
37825660901 9408818941 28
98 11533 28627946
See more
22 28909616179 04817005173
386 6628044 2493
See more